Data flow in Power BI Service

Hi,

How can I edit a data flow in Power BI Service, and automatically have the new edition in Power BI service?

I mean, have some changes in DataFlow in a workspace, then after refreshing, see those changes in the connected reports in the PBI service. I tried it, but the reports that use that Data Flow, don't show the changes.

But on PBI Desktop files (connected to the same Data Flow), I can see the changes after updating.

Do you have any idea?

Because I don't like to download the files from the cloud, update them on-premises, then upload them again (for each change).

Many thanks...

You will need to refresh the dataset for the reports in the service that use the dataflow

You can set them up with a scheduled refresh or you can do it on demand in the service as well

If your reports only use data from the dataflows then is should be easy to setup
